SafeJSON.dev's answer
Safejson runs all JSON processing 100% locally in the user's browser, never uploading any sensitive JSON payloads to external servers. Most competing JSON tools send your confidential data to their backends for parsing, while we guarantee end-to-end client-side privacy alongside a full suite of JSON utilities like diff comparison and JWT decoding.
SafeJSON.dev's answer
Frontend built with vanilla JavaScript + modern browser native APIs for local file handling and parsing, lightweight CSS framework for responsive UI, Lemon Squeezy for subscription & license management, pure client-side JSON parsing libraries with no server-side data persistence.

SafeJSON.dev's answer
As a developer, I repeatedly faced anxiety when pasting sensitive API JSON into public online formatters, knowing the data could be logged or leaked on third-party servers. I built SafeJSON to fix this pain point: a fully client-side JSON toolkit that keeps all user data local, while packing all the everyday features developers need, and launched it as an indie MicroSaaS with fair pricing.
